Limestone, Maine is 253 miles NE of Portland, Maine (center to center) and 352 miles NE of Boston, Massachusetts. It is in Aroostook county. The population of the town is 2,361.
In Limestone, about 48% of adults are married.
Approximately 10% of Limestone is non-white. The town is home to people of a variety of races.
It's notable that men are disproportionately common in Limestone.
In 2000, Limestone had a median family income of $39,135.
The Republican party attracted the largest share of donations from Limestone.
Of the housing in Limestone, approximately 65% is occupied by their owners. Property taxes in the town are low by Maine standards.
In Limestone, 96% of commuters drive to work. It's harder to live without a car in Limestone than most towns its size. The town features shorter commuting times than most similar places.
